Role of Cast and Community Organisation as Social Change Maker

How Cast, Community and Religion based Organisations and Unions can work for uplifting the society as Social Change maker by establishing Social Responsibility Cells?

How NGO and Social Activists can play a positive social change maker role by associating, communicating, motivating and inspiring cast and community based organisations to established as and to work as Social Responsibility Cells?

There are various committees, organisations and groups of different religions, castes and creeds working to uplift their subjects. These groups and organisations conduct social programmes in which the society, caste and religion play a peculiar role. Many organisations belonging to different castes/ religions have performed a significant role in abhorring dowry system and creating awareness about this evil prevalent even in today’s world. These organisations encourage and even organise community marriages where marriages are solemnised in minimum expenses even though all the customs are followed whole heartedly. This is an exemplary effort that inspires others to do something for the betterment of their society.

The motivational guidance and suggestions for implementation are:

  1. Motivate and eEncourage children of your community/ society to study. For this you can chalk out agenda during the community meetings and conduct surveys to know about the families whose children are unable to attend schools. You can sponsor their education by organising crowd funding within your community in case the parents or families of children are unable to afford one.
  2. Organise ceremonies to recognise, patronize and promote talented individuals of your community. This is a very effective tool in inspiring others to achieve similar success and encourage the existing ones into achieving more milestones. This will even give a platform to various talented individuals among your community to come forward and display their talent. Community can organise workshops; training sessions increase the skills of their youth. This will give the students an opportunity to learn more apart from the limited opportunities that their schools and colleges might be offering. Their chances of being employed increases.
  3. Community can form an information cell that shares information about various government jobs and private jobs among the youth. They must contain and share data like current job openings, last date to fill forms, eligibility criteria, results etc.
  4. Community should come together to form a wing that encourages start-up culture among young generation and helps young entrepreneurs by providing easy loans, micro funding etc. Such organisations can guide these talented youngsters about making best use of their skill and knowledge according to the prevalent circumstances. Upliftment of younger generation leads to the welfare of the entire community.
  5. Community can form an information broadcasting cell to share the data accumulated from various sources like Government, information sharing with other communities, Non-Governmental Organisations etc.
  6. Community can make efforts to help its members to gain benefits of various Government schemes. This can be done by educating them about various schemes, their eligibility and requirements like documentation to avail benefits. Sometimes, few corrupt officials sitting at important government posts can pose trouble in getting access to such benefits. Combined community efforts force them to bow down in front of organised power of masses which in turn enables the rightful candidates to access the benefits they are rightfully entitled for.
  7. Solemnising a marriage has become a very costly affair these days. To ease the burden, community can organise cultural programmes from time to time where youngsters can meet each other. Communities can even formulate a separate cell that keeps record of eligible bachelors and provides various platforms to let them communicate with each other. This will help families in searching bride/ bridegroom as per their needs and wishes even across the other states/ in the entire country.
  8. Since ages many communities have been organising community marriages where many couples tie the holy thread of matrimony. Such events save a lot of money and help people with weak economic background to ease their burden by marrying at relatively much lower costs. These functions should be encouraged across all communities. Representatives of various communities can hold meetings to share their experiences among themselves and evolve various strategies to propagate this concept and idea.
  9. Community can work efficiently to promote harmony among families even after marriage. Counseling cell of community can guide and counsel members of family to promote harmony among themselves in case of disputes, suggest ways to solve an existing family crisis, address issues that might be getting ignored by a member of the family but is relevant to the other one. In case one party is residing at another city then members of community at that place can interact with the ones at the other end to solve a crisis.
  10. Members of the community can join hands to increase their efforts in letting others gain access to government schemes, avail loans from Government/ private banks. Sometimes individuals face difficulty in getting their loans passed but if the community cooperates it becomes easy. Community can also provide information about the banks that are friendly and have transparent procedure of passing a loan.
  11. Community can even set up a loan fund to finance deserving candidates.
  12. Communities can organise health checkup camps fortnightly, half yearly or yearly to promote awareness about health and encourage people to make healthy life choices. Community members can help their peers who are from weak economic background to avail Government health benefits. They can even formulate a Non-Governmental Organisation to help such candidates receive medical aid at much lower or negligible costs.
  13. There are certain diseases which cannot be treated at Government Hospitals or require huge amount of money for treatment. Their diagnosis, medicines, treatment all cost high and sometimes the sufferer has to sell his property to afford it. In such cases, community can help them by crowd funding, or help them gain access to medical aid being provided by NGOs working in this field or even provide them loan. In Delhi and in Rajasthan in Government hospitals the treatments are free or at low cost but community based organisation can better guide and help to the patients of their own community. Community based organisations can also guide in better way about the free health and medical facilities provided at Government hospitals.
  14. There are some private hospitals providing health care benefits and medical aid at relatively much lower costs. Their main aim is public welfare. Communities can keep a record of such hospitals and provide information about them to the needy candidates. They can even take help of NGOs to access such information.
  15. In every community there are some unfortunate senior citizens who have nobody to take care of them. Communities can come forward to establish full time or part time old age homes for them where they can live the rest of their lives peacefully. They can even motivate community members to donate in cash or kind for such old age homes to provide facilities like medical aid, healthy foods, clothing etc.
